Getting There

  • Walking

    From the center of Gásadalur, start at the main road (Gásadalsvegur) and head southwest. Follow the signs that indicate the trail to Drangarnir. The trail is well-marked and takes you through beautiful landscapes. Expect the walk to take about 1.5 to 2 hours, depending on your pace. Make sure to wear sturdy walking shoes and dress for the weather, as it can change quickly.

  • Public Transport

    If you are using public transport, take the bus service from Tórshavn to Gásadalur, which runs several times a day. Once you arrive in Gásadalur, follow the same walking instructions to reach Drangarnir. Note that bus tickets cost around 30 DKK (Danish Krone) one way, and the journey takes approximately 1.5 hours.

  • Private Car

    If you are traveling by car, drive to Gásadalur via Route 10. Once in Gásadalur, you can park your car near the village center. From there, follow the walking trail to Drangarnir as described above. Remember that parking may be limited, so it’s best to arrive early.

Nestled in the heart of the Faroe Islands, Drangarnir stands as a magnificent testament to nature's artistry. This striking formation consists of two towering sea stacks that rise dramatically from the Atlantic Ocean, creating a breathtaking scene that has become emblematic of the islands' rugged beauty. Surrounded by the vibrant greens of the cliffs and the deep blues of the sea, Drangarnir is a paradise for nature lovers and photographers alike. The area is not just about aesthetics; it offers a unique opportunity to witness the powerful forces of erosion and geology at work. The sea stacks are accessible via scenic hiking trails that meander along the coastline, providing visitors with stunning panoramic views of the surrounding landscape. The tranquility here is palpable, allowing for moments of reflection amidst the natural splendor. As you explore this enchanting locale, keep an eye out for the diverse birdlife that inhabits the cliffs, including puffins and other seabirds, making it a perfect spot for birdwatching enthusiasts.
